The RCMP have resumed their search efforts for a man last seen in Portugal Cove South on Friday morning.
68-year-old Loyola Hartery was last seen at 5:45 Friday morning leaving his home on an ATV. He was reported missing Saturday morning.
He was last seen wearing a blue and white woods jacket, blue coveralls, and a black open-faced helmet. His ATV is a red Honda 500.

Search efforts took place yesterday involving Ground Search and Rescue, provincial air services, the Joint Rescue Coordination Centre and searchers from the community.
According to police, more volunteers for the search effort are not needed at this time as it may hamper the effort if volunteer safety becomes a concern.
However, they are asking cabin owners in the area of Portugal Cove South to check any trail cams for video that may yield clues.
Anyone with information is asked to contact Holyrood RCMP at 709-229-3892.
